FIRST RESPONDERS “BOX OUT” BULLYING!
Members of First Responders Lions Club attended Cops & Kids Boxing Gym in Brooklyn to speak with the youth.
Lions NYPD Detectives Stacey Robinson, James Tillman, Francis Ainoo, Teriq Grant were accompanied by Charter President Dimple
Willabus. They were greeted by the Founder of Cops & Kids, Retired NYPD Sergeant Pat Russo. He gave a tour of the state of the art
boxing gym which is located in the basement of Flatbush Gardens Housing complex.
The boxing gym is open to the youth in the community who express an interest in working out and train to box for free!
First Responders Lions spoke with the youth regarding their individual experiences as a young person and their path to becoming
police officers.
Additionally, the Lions explained the importance of staying focused in school, making constructive decisions about their future, selecting
friends wisely. They were urged to utilize every opportunity to stay fit, and also build a network of long standing relationships with
community stakeholders.
The visit could not be complete without the Lions testing out some of the equipment from the facility!
